Justin Bieber’s Crew Refuse To Do Shows In Japan

After all the turmoil that’s happened in Japan over the last month and a half, they could probably use the revenue that would be generated by a Justin Bieber concert. However, that’s not likely to happen. Members of Bieber’s stage crew have refused to go to Japan for two shows that are scheduled for May 17th and 19th in Osaka and Tokyo. According to sources who spoke with TMZ, crew members were fearful of cancer and other illnesses due to radiation poisoning from the nuclear disaster.

The Biebs’s manager Scooter Braun freaked out at the crew telling them to “Man the f*** up and do right by these kids”.

The crew fired back saying that both Avril Lavigne and Slash had canceled their concerts in Japan, even though the Japanese government has given the ‘all clear’ that the area is safe.
